Student with advisorAcademic advising is one of the most important services offered by Salisbury University.  It is a process that helps students identify their career goals and assists them in the development of an educational plan designed to meet these goals. degree-seeking students at Salisbury University are assigned an academic advisor.  Students who have a declared major are assigned a faculty advisor within their major department, while students who have not declared their major are assigned faculty or professional advisors by the Office of Academic Affairs.

Students must confer with their assigned academic advisor during "Program Planning" in the fall and spring semesters.  It is during these conferences that course selections for the upcoming semester, general education and major requirements, long term academic planning, and academic issues are discussed.  It is the responsibility of the student for meeting all University and departmental major graduation requirements.
